Modern Wood Burners

Modern wood burners are a blend of stylish designs, efficient heating and ecological considerations. They are a great addition to any house and offer an alternative source of heat in case of power outages.

They are more efficient at heating rooms than fireplaces and emit considerably less harmful gasses. However wood stoves still release up to six times more particle pollution than modern diesel cars.

The Jotul F 305 LL

The Jotul F 305 LL, one of the most recent models from the Jotul collection is a stunning cast iron stove. With an open combustion chamber that is horizontal, this cast iron stove is able to accommodate large logs of wood and provides a stunning view of the flames. It also features a practical ash drawer and easy air controls. It also has a quiet combustion system which reduces emissions. This model is available with an air-tight heat shield on the rear and an soapstone top to improve the contemporary design.

The F 305 series has a horizontal design that makes it easy to put logs in and offers a rapid 10kW peak heat transfer to the room thanks to integrated convection. It was created by Norwegian designers Anderssen & Voll, merging 160 years of heating experience with timeless design. The long-leg version of the F 305 is available in white enamel and features a lighter finish that shows off the flames of the fire to the fullest. The horizontal combustion chamber is perfect for burning large pieces of wood. The simple air controls make it easy to use.

The Jotul GF 305 DV IPI gas version is a cast iron model of the well-known F 305 LL. The sleek, modern design is framed with smooth curves. The extra-large view of the flame creates a stunning effect in your living room. The fire can be accessed through the glass doors that covers 70 percent of the front face, providing an unobstructed view of the flames. Its high-performance features include an easy-to-install direct vent system as well as integrated heat convection which reduces the distance to combustible substances on the back of the stove.

When you are preparing firewood to burn in a wood stove it is crucial to stack the logs correctly to ensure that the firewood remain dry and ready to be burned when needed. Airflow is crucial to drying firewood, so leave space between logs and keep their ends even. In addition, protecting the small wood burning stove for shed from the elements by storing them in covered structures or tarps helps in drying and preserving their quality.

The round stack method is a well-known method to stack firewood. It is simple to use and looks stunning. Create a base by spreading out three to four rows of treated 2x4s, or pallets. Then, build an end pillar stack on top of the base by laying 3-4 pieces of wood next to each other, and then placing another piece on the opposite side with bigger gaps at each end. Continue to build these pillars until the stack is 12 rows high, ensuring that there are enough spaces between each one to ensure that air flows easily throughout the entire pile.

Then, use a center stake to hold the stack upright and begin adding perpendicular pieces to the outside of the stack, tying them together with string. Repeat this process until you have reached the ceiling height of your wall. You can then add in interior space with oddball pieces and those that are too large for the outer rows. It is crucial to remember that indoor stacking requires a space with a lot of natural light and good airflow. Because overcrowding the stack could result in damp and moldy wood. The best indoor space for stacking is typically a basement or garage.

The Short Penguin Eco

The Short Penguin Eco from Chilli Penguin is an excellent example of a green wood burner. Its clean lines and solid construction make it a stylish choice for modern homes or those who prefer a bit of traditional style. The multi-fuel stove 5kw can burn both wood and smokeless fuel. It has a huge ceramic window so you can see the flames dancing. It has an oven which allows you to cook food on it or boil water to make hot drinks.

The stove has three clean burn options that result in emission levels that are low and have over 80% efficiency. They include secondary heat retaining glazing as well as combustion air jets and air flow diversion. The result is an efficient stove that can also be employed in smoke-control zones.

This stove is the smallest models in the domestic range. It can be hung on a wall by adding the plinth or log store. The design is sleek and contemporary, with stainless steel handles. This is a stove that you'll be delighted to return home to.
